Returning to the previous graph, we can see that this is not a function since the points \((3,1)\) and \((3,6)\) intersect the same vertical line. If a vertical line intersects a curve on an xy-plane more than once then for one value of x the curve has more than one value of y, and so, the curve does not represent a function. Vertical line test. 2.1 Functions: definition, notation A function is a rule (correspondence) that assigns to each element x of one set , say X, one and only one element y of another set, Y. The set X is called the domain of the function and the set of all elements of the set Y that are associated with some element of the set X is called the range of the function.
